How to Get Your New York Real Estate License

Total Cost to Get Licensed in New York

Pre-licensing education (77 hrs)$350-$700
Exam fee$15
License application fee$55
Background check$50
Total estimate$470-$820

Most candidates are licensed within 5-10 weeks of passing the exam.

Salesperson License

Who is this for?

This license is ideal for individuals new to real estate who want to start their career helping clients buy and sell property To obtain a Salesperson license, you must be sponsored by a licensed broker or brokerage firm.

Requirements

Age18+
ExperienceEntry-Level
SponsorshipRequired

Your Exam

Questions75
Time1h 30m
Format75 State
Passing Score Progress70%

You need roughly 53 out of 75 questions correct to pass.

Renewal: Every 2 years • 22 CE hours required

To upgrade: 2 years experience

New York Real Estate License Reciprocity

New York has partial reciprocity agreements with select states. Agents licensed in a recognized state may qualify to skip some pre-licensing education, but must still pass the New York-specific state exam.

Reciprocity rules change. Verify current requirements with each state's real estate commission before applying.
